ROLE SUMMARY:
- Inspired Education Group is seeking an enthusiastic and dynamic Senior Preparatory Dance Teacher to join our team at Reddam House Durbanville on a part-time, permanent basis from January 2026.
- The successful candidate will inspire students through engaging, high-quality Dance teaching, nurturing creativity and confidence while upholding the highest standards of performance and discipline. This is an exciting opportunity to join a leading global education group renowned for its commitment to academic excellence, performing arts, and holistic development.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Plan, prepare, and deliver engaging and progressive Dance lessons that inspire and challenge students in the Senior Preparatory phase.
- Establish a nurturing and stimulating classroom environment that encourages creativity, participation, and excellence.
- Set, assess, and record student work; provide timely and constructive feedback to enhance learning outcomes.
- Evaluate and continuously improve teaching practice through reflection and professional development.
- Contribute to school productions, performances, and extracurricular events that showcase student talent.
- Maintain effective communication with parents, responding promptly to messages and queries.
- Attend school events, staff meetings, and professional development sessions as required.
- Promote the school’s ethos of respect, responsibility, and personal growth.
THE IDEAL CANDIDATE WILL HAVE:
- A university degree with Certified Teaching Status (or equivalent).
- A minimum of 3 years’ experience teaching Dance to students in the Senior Preparatory phase.
- Strong classroom management and lesson planning skills.
- Confidence in using ICT to enhance teaching and learning.
- A genuine passion for Dance and the performing arts, coupled with a commitment to student wellbeing and development.
- Excellent organisational, communication, and interpersonal skills.
- The ability to work collaboratively and contribute positively to school life.
